Massimiliano and Doriana Fuksas. The Cloud. New Rome-Eur Convention Centre
New Convention Centre is a work of outstanding artistic merit, featuring innovative logistics solutions, and a choice of technically advanced materials. The structure rises in the historic EUR quarter and covers a surface of 55,000 square metres. The project concept can be defined in three images: the Theca, the Cloud and the Lama of the hotel structure.0The Cloud, or true core of the project, is enclosed inside the Theca box underlining the contrast between the organization of free space without rules, and a geometrically defined form. It contains an auditorium with seating for 1,850, cafés and snack bars, and support services for the auditorium. This book narrates the complete detailed history of this monumental architectural work and its construction through numerous and evocative images of the work site showing the complexity of the construction stages and the special techniques that were necessary. There are also photos of the completed building, by internationally renowned photographers. The preface of this monographic publication in single Italian or English language, is a critical essay by Joseph Giovannini, and is completed with very rich iconographic material composed of technical drawings on various scales, and sketches by Massimiliano Fuksas, author of the work together with Doriana Fuksas. The book has been published on various types of paper and differently sized sheets which are inserted within the pages.
